The selected option emphasizes the importance of implementing language acquisition strategies and providing cultural relevance in lessons, which is a comprehensive approach to supporting English Language Learners (ELLs). Effective education for ELLs requires educators to engage with their unique linguistic and cultural backgrounds to facilitate language development and ensure meaningful learning experiences.

Implementing language acquisition strategies means that educators are using techniques specifically designed to help students acquire a new language. This includes scaffolding instruction, using visuals, and encouraging collaborative learning that allows ELLs to practice speaking and comprehension in a supportive environment.

Cultural relevance in lessons acknowledges students' backgrounds and experiences, which can impact their learning. When lessons are related to students' cultures, they are more likely to engage with the material and connect it to their lives. This relevance helps to validate their identities and experiences, fostering a supportive classroom community.

By combining these approaches, educators create an inclusive learning environment that meets the linguistic and emotional needs of ELLs, ultimately supporting their overall academic success.
